Comedian Phoebe Robinson narrates her second collection of essays with all the vim and vigor for which she's known. Fans will be delighted with this volume, which offers more snarky observations about everyday life in her signature sarcasm. From breaking her own dating rules to her mother's snail-like pace in getting ready for major events, Robinson pulls back the curtain on her personal life. Listeners will be laughing out loud--and along--with her observations on everything from how to handle microaggressions to choosing not to be a parent. This intimate and fun listening experience will draw people in for its honesty, warmth, and humor. We can only hope life keeps throwing her curveballs and Robinson keeps taking notes.
